Government-run firms drove capex in pre-election year as private sector held back

After a strong rebound in private capital expenditure in the two years following the pandemic, investment by private non-financial corporations stagnated in FY24. In contrast, capital spending by public non-financial enterprises jumped 33%, while central and state governments increased theirs by 25%. Qatar’s wealth fund plans to double US investments; may revise fixed income strategy

The Qatar Investment Authority (QIA) aims to at least double its annual investments in the US over the next decade, compared to the past five years. China’s fixed-asset investment up 4% in Jan-April

BEIJING – China”s fixed-asset investment went up 4 percent year-on-year in the first four months of 2025, official data showed Monday. Excluding the property sector, the country’s fixed-asset investment grew 8 percent year-on-year during this period, according to the National Bureau of Statistics (NBS).
